I took a quick look at the DTD at the site and there are
no less than 112 attributes and 113 elements defined.
Most of them appear to me to be META data. I think one
approach is to obtain or create some instance documents
and tnen define what output you want to see out of XSLT.
This list can help with the XSLT if you have a particular
problem but your have to trim your questions to specific
stylesheet/transformation issues.
